Transfer of d-Level quantum states through spin chains by random swapping

Abstract

We generalize an already proposed protocol for quantum state transfer to spin chains of arbitrary spin. An arbitrary unknown d- level state is transferred through a chain with rather good fidelity by the natural dynamics of the chain. We compare the performance of this protocol for various values of d. A by-product of our study is a much simpler method for picking up the state at the destination as compared with the one proposed previously. We also discuss entanglement distribution through such chains and show that the quality of entanglement transition increases with the number of levels d.
